Sitecode: 60483
Very large campsite with new sanitary buildings. Cozy bar, nice staff, where you can eat well. You can choose your own spot and be completely free. The beach nearby is beautiful. The only downside are the mosquitoes from 6 pm to 10 pm!
Sitecode: 57754
Way too expensive for what you get, everyone leaves after 1 night. 2 people, a dog and a camper van pay around 60 per night. We see in Alghero that you pay less for a hotel room!! And what do you get? -a man with a noisy lawnmower all day long - a bench around your wrist and a lot of red tape. The location is beautiful on the water near the sea.
Sitecode: 72485
Very nice small sweet campsite with views, beautifully clean sanitary facilities. The camping owner is super friendly and serves delicious local organic dishes in his Inn. We had a very nice time there. Tip: stand on the edge.

Sitecode: 8310
Grumpy camping boss, 40 euros per night for 2 people with a dog. There is a lot of space, if no people stand right next to you, on the Danube but no view of it. A nice transit camp site because the town of Grien is nearby.
Sitecode: 86140
This campsite has large spacious pitches and it is quiet. There is a restaurant. The sanitary facilities are super good, accessible with a pass. There is cooking facilities and there is a room to stay in bad weather with TV! But the best part is that it borders on a nature reserve and a beautiful swimming lake. We are satisfied.
Sitecode: 94894
The view is beautiful wide. There are gypsy wagons for rent. There is a field for passers-by and tents. There are very few showers and toilets, what there is is neat. Also saw a lot of youth with loud music.

Sitecode: 68518
Large campsite with many permanent pitches on the Baltic Sea. For Campers there is a small field behind the playground. Great for 1 night. You can swim in the sea.
